LONG BEACH, Calif. (AP) - Authorities say five male students have been arrested on suspicion of sexual battery after two ninth grade girls were attacked at a Long Beach high school.
Long Beach Police Lt. Ty Hatfield says one of the victims told Poly High School officials they were groped on their breasts and buttocks during a lunch break Tuesday.
The five freshman boys were arrested separately throughout the week as the investigation into the assault progressed.
Hatfield says the attack may not have been an isolated incident and investigators are looking for any other victims who may not have come forward.
None of the suspects has been identified because they are minors.
